Microloans

If you're a small business owner, you're probably wondering how you can fund your business through micro loans. Microloans are an excellent way for small businesses to save money and purchase supplies. Many small-scale companies are seasonal and need funds to replenish inventory or furnish their offices. If your business is seasonal, microloans are an great options for working capital.

In order to finance your business idea The first step is to determine what kind of microloan is best suited to your requirements. Microloans are often referred to as "starter loans", which means that they are easier to get and process than traditional loans. When you're planning your loan application, however, it's vital to plan ahead for the process. Collect all the information you require for your financial houses and business plan.

The most popular microloan provider is the U.S. Small Business Administration which offers up to $50,000 for small-sized businesses. The typical microloan amount is $13,000. The majority of microloans can be repaid over six years. The interest rate on microloans can vary based on the lender. However, it's typically between eight and thirteen percent. The amount of the loan varies on the risk and the necessity of the business. You must be aware of these terms prior to you apply.

Lines of credit

If you are considering a line of credit for your business, make sure you are aware of the terms of the loan. Business lines of credit allow you to access funds when required. You will receive a monthly statement that outlines the use of your credit and the amount due. The credit can be used to meet your business's needs and you can repay it whenever you want. A line-of-credit works in the same way as a credit card for business, except that you do not receive an amount in one lump. Instead, you pay off your debts using your credit line , and pay your financier. Interest will be charged if you aren't able to pay your balance. As you pay off your balance your credit line will increase.

A business line of credit is a very popular option for small-sized businesses to pay for their short-term cash needs. Venture capital

To get venture capital, the startup team has to draft a document known as the VC term sheet, which details the financial guidelines of the investment. It should include the funding section, which specifies the amount of investment as well as the liquidation, corporate governance, and exit sections which define the rights of investors as well as shareholders. The business plan must clearly outline how the VC will use capital. If the team is limited in resources, they can hire professionals on a fractional basis. In addition an accounting table for capitalization must be created, identifying all the owners of the business and tracking issued versus authorized stock options, unvested rights, and options. Investors want to know everything about the business and its future growth.
